Cool thing about Doom 3 engine is that you can use the assets from the Demo as well as an HD texture pack you can find online.
Doom 3 also has an open source VR implementation.
I think with some shader tweaks someone could bring https://github.com/RobertBeckebans/RBDOOM-3-BFG up to par with ID Tech 5.
They actually implemented PBR in it but it was alpha irrc
